Output 71680017f744eb6ecca53cc7836090cae61c5733cf1e04a7a1544ddfb1cfe2ce:4

value
5380492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285dec0da63164235e1add860e4a3d1b53712afd OP_EQUAL
address
35NTU399abPwc424aRtXy2uvpdJARm7tCu
transaction
71680017f744eb6ecca53cc7836090cae61c5733cf1e04a7a1544ddfb1cfe2ce
confirmations
191598
spent
true